Road
- Companies: Hire from Avis, Hertz, or local rental companies
- Duration: Approximately 7 hours
- Distance: 742 kilometers
- Costs: Approximately 80 EUR (fuel costs included, rental prices may vary)
- Roads/Routes: Use the M1 Pacific Motorway which offers the quickest and most direct route.
Pro Tip: Make sure to take rest stops at service areas along the M1, as they are well-equipped for refreshments and stretching your legs which is especially important on long drives.
Driving offers not only flexibility on your schedule but also an opportunity to explore scenic views and hidden gems along the way.
Bus
- Companies: Greyhound Australia, Premier Motor Service
- Duration: Approximately 10 hours
- Distance: 742 kilometers
- Costs: Approximately 60 EUR
- Roads/Routes: Travel along the M1 Pacific Motorway.
Pro Tip: Bring a portable charger and snacks to make the journey more comfortable, as bus services may not provide meals or adequate charging ports.
Bus travel is perfect for budget travelers and those who prefer to relax and enjoy the scenery without the stress of driving.
